Question
For a perfectly mixed continuous flow tank reactor (CSTR) at steady state, which of the following statements is NOT true:
(a). there is no time dependence of temperature within the reactor
(b). there is no position dependence of temperature within the reactor
(c). the concentration inside the reactor is an average between that of the inlet and that of the outlet
(d). the concentration in the outlet is identical to that inside the reactor
(e). the concentration anywhere in the reactor is equal to the outlet concentration
Explanation / Answer
(c) the concentration inside the reactor is an average between that of the inlet and that of the outlet. ( NOT TRUE)
Beacuse concentration in side the reactor is depend on rate of reaction.
Note : CSTR is generally have no spatial variations in concentrations, temperature, or reaction rate throughout the vessel.
